    Default RE: What is after the highchair?

    Gone both ways, cooshie booster & then with #3 the kinderzeat.

    For less $$ investment the cooshie is decent however since it doesn't height adjust it can be an issue with some tables/childrens heights etc. Plus i had to give up on mine for my girls as my little boy would run about chewing on them x(

    So with them i later switched over to some ikea toddler chairs, pretty cheap and cute ;)

    With #3 i went for broke and got the kinderzeat as i needed something more adjustable, it's worked very well...very easy to clean and stable..he really likes sitting in it & this is a child who doesn't sit still on the whole.

    Even my 5yo likes the kinderzeat, actually they all fight over *sigh* LOL

    Anyhow my experience, FWIW
